Bonehead move of the day
Up here in Ontario we have a drive clean program to have the car smog tested before renewal tags are issued. I've had few problems with my S and it passed it's first test fine. Thinking I would be smart, I reset the ECU (there were no codes, but still, I went ahead). The car failed because the testing computer couldn't find most the sensors. So now I need to drive it, have the sensors etc. come back online, then take it back (I'll have to pay a small fee for a retest). Sometimes, when you're trying to be extra 'smart' ... you're being extra stupid.
Live and learn - hopefully you don't run into the same issue! :cheers: |

End of last year I was due for inspection, I failed because 2 monitors (SAI and Evap) were incomplete. After messing around looking for SAI leaks, doing all the driving steps, no luck. I was a month away from retest so I decided for first time to go to an Indie. They found issues with evap and made the repairs. When I picked up the car the evap and SAI were still incomplete. I have bluetooth ODBII and app on my phone so I could watch while I drive. On the way home from shop (10-15 miles) I took a quick spin up the Hwy and finally the Evap went complete. I had read that some states allow 1 monitor to be in incomplete status. For the 10 mins I had until I reached the inspection station, I was hoping I didn't get some CEL. I passed as NJ does allow 1 monitor not to complete. Now I'm bugged to figure out what's the issue with the SAI. I just better not wait until last week to fix
Get some type of reader so you can drive and monitor the Monitors. Then you will know when to take it to the station Good Luck |

If drive cycle fails try this. I fought this issue with SAI several years ago. On a cold start immediately rev to 2700 rpm and hold it steady during the 90 sec. Did this sitting in the garage parked. No need to drive it. This has worked several times for me.
